Juda Leib Jacob Levie, birth 1661 Leeuwarden, died 3 Feb 1706 Leeuwarden, info from: 'Relations among Early Jewish Settlers in Dutch Friesland etc', by Chaim Caran, Eilat, at International Congres on Jewish Genealogy, Jerusalem, July 2004:
buried at Beth Haim cemetery at Ouderkerk, the Sephardic graveyard near Amsterdam.
Tombstone reading:
'Here was buried
Juda may he reside in security, and the Lion [Arie = Lion is synonym for Juda] hidden in a rock cave; the upright and honorable khr"r Judaleib bar Jacob halevi, who heroic as a lion circumcised hundreds of sons of the Hebrews and passed through Ju da ['chalaf bijehuda' also: the[circumciser's] knife in Juda['s hands]] and did charity and good deeds in honesty; 'and it was in the end' 'and Juda approached' 'and he lived' for 42 years, [text according to the names of 3 consecutive portion s of weekly Torah-readings from the book Exodus], and he was gathered to his people in his full adornment 'Juda became his sanctuary' on Wednesday 19 Shevat 466 [3 Feb 1706], may his soul be bundled in the bundle of life.

1) Isaac Itsak Levie Judaleib Levie Leeuwarden-Segal, birth 1680 Leeuwarden, info from: 'Relations among Early Jewish Settlers in Dutch Friesland etc', by Chaim Caran, Eilat, at International Congres on Jewish Genealogy, Jerusalem, July 2004., died Jul 1750 Leeuwarden, info from: 'Relations among Early Jewish Settlers in Dutch Friesland etc', by Chaim Caran, Eilat, at International Congres on Jewish Genealogy, Jerusalem, July 2004:
Tombstone 372 of Brilleman collection:
'And Isaac went to converse in the field'
Here is buried a good man, his deeds are glorious, to circumcise all male who carry the covenant in truth; the aluf, katsin may his memory be for blessing and goodwill, pum Itsak Segal, alias Itsak Leeuwarden, son of the chaver torani the late khr "r Judaleib z.l. Segal;
he died on Tuesday before midnight, 10 Tammuz, and was buried the day after, Wednesday 11 Tammuz; 'and may you lie down and your sleep be agreeable'
[year 510] may his soul be bundled in the bundle of life.
